BUFFALO CHICKEN MEATBALLS WITH BLUE CHEESE SAUCE
Provided by Sunny Anderson
Categories appetizer
Time 1h35m
Yield 16 meatballs
Number Of Ingredients 20
Steps:
- For the blue cheese sauce: Combine the mayonnaise, blue cheese, sour cream, buttermilk, honey and garlic powder in a bowl and whisk until blended. Set aside.
- For the buffalo chicken meatballs: Heat the olive oil in a medium saute pan over medium heat. Add the onion and saute until soft and translucent, 5 to 8 minutes. Let cool.
- In large bowl, combine the buttermilk, torn bread and 2 tablespoons of the hot sauce and mix to form a paste. Add the ground chicken, breadcrumbs, ranch dressing mix, egg and 1/2 cup of the diced celery and mix with your hands until combined.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
-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il and spray with cooking spray.
- Form the meatball mixture into 16 even mini patties, about 2 1/2 inches in diameter. Place a cube of blue cheese in the center of a patty and wrap the meat around the cheese. Roll into a uniform ball and place on the prepared baking sheet. Continue with the remaining patties and cheese cubes, making sure to wash your hands in cold water a few times between rolling to keep the meatballs from sticking to your hands. Bake the meatballs until lightly browned, 15 to 20 minutes.
- While the meatballs bake, prepare the buffalo sauce. In a medium pot over medium-low heat, combine the butter, honey and remaining 1 cup hot sauce. Heat until the butter is melted, whisking until well blended. Continue to cook until the sauce is heated through.
- Transfer the meatballs to a large mixing bowl and pour over the buffalo sauce. Gently toss to coat and transfer to a platter. Garnish with a drizzle of the blue cheese sauce and the remaining 1/4 cup diced celery. Serve the rest of the blue cheese sauce on the side.
BUFFALO CHICKEN BITES WITH BLUE CHEESE DIPPING SAUCE
Enjoy these fried chicken bites coated with Bisquick® mix and cornmeal mixture. Serve these appetizers with dipping sauce.
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Appetizer
Time 55m
Yield 40
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- In medium bowl, mix egg white and Buffalo wing sauce. Stir in chicken. Cover; refrigerate 30 minutes.
- Line cookie sheet with waxed paper. In large resealable food-storage plastic bag, place Bisquick mix, cornmeal, salt and pepper. With slotted spoon, remove 1/4 of chicken pieces from bowl and add to bag; seal bag and shake to coat. Repeat with remaining chicken pieces. Tap off excess Bisquick mixture and place chicken on cookie sheet.
- In small bowl, mix dipping sauce ingredients until well combined. Cover; refrigerate until serving time.
- In 10-inch nonstick skillet, heat oil (1/4 inch) over medium-high heat 2 to 4 minutes. Cook chicken bites in oil in batches, about 1/3 at a time, 3 to 4 minutes, turning once, until golden brown. Drain on paper towels. Serve chicken with dipping sauce.

BUFFALO WINGS WITH BLUE CHEESE DIPPING SAUCE
Buffalo wings were arguably one of my favorite foods to eat this past year. I love them, and they are incredibly easy to make at home. The balance of sweet and spicy in this recipe is fantastic; great for any game day!
Provided by Kelsey Nixon
Categories appetizer
Time 1h35m
Yield 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Place the chicken wings in large resealable bag in a shallow baking dish.
- Melt the butter in a small saucepan and remove from the heat. Stir in the honey, hot sauce, paprika, salt and cayenne pepper. Let cool completely and pour over the chicken wings. Seal the bag and let marinate at room temperature 25 to 30 minutes. Drain and discard the marinade.
-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 425 degrees F. Line a large sheet tray with aluminum foil and spray with nonstick spray.
- Bake the chicken on the sheet tray, flipping once halfway through cooking, 35 minutes.
- Serve alongside the Blue Cheese Dipping Sauce and celery sticks.
- Combine the blue cheese, mayonnaise, sour cream and Worcestershire sauce together in mixing bowl or food processor and mix until combined. Season with salt and pepper.

BUFFALO CHICKEN QUINOA BITES WITH BLUE CHEESE DIPPING SAUCE
A healthier twist on traditional boneless buffalo chicken wings that's just ingenious and easy to make. From Nature Box's site.
Provided by rpgaymer
Categories Chicken Breast
Time 45m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- In a small bowl, combine Greek yogurt, blue cheese, garlic, dill, parsley, salt and pepper, to taste; set aside in the refrigerator.
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Lightly oil a mini muffin pan or coat with nonstick spray.
- In a large bowl, combine quinoa, chicken, goat cheese, sharp cheddar, buffalo sauce, Panko, egg, flour, salt and pepper.
- Scoop the mixture evenly into the muffin tray, about 1 1/2 tablespoons for each. Place into oven and bake for 18-20 minutes, or until golden and set. Serve immediately with dipping sauce.

BUFFALO CHICKEN AND BLUE CHEESE DIPPING SAUCE
Make and share this Buffalo Chicken and Blue Cheese Dipping Sauce recipe from Food.com.
Provided by iris5555
Categories Chicken Breast
Time 21m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Dipping Sauce: Combine all ingredients in a small bowl, mixing well.
- With the back of the mixing spoon, mash the blue cheese into the sour cream until almost all of the lumps are gone.
- Chill in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our before serving.
- Chicken: Soak the chicken in the hot sauce in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es.
- Put the flour in a pie tin and season with salt and Cajun seasoning.
- Remove chicken from hot sauce, shake off excess, and dredge chicken in the flour.
- Set on a baking rack.
- Heat the butter and o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
- When the butter has stopped bubbling, add the chicken tenders and cook until golden and cooked through, about 3 minutes per side.
- Remove from the pan and drain on paper towels.
- Serve warm with blue cheese dipping sauce and celery pieces.
BUFFALO CHICKEN SKEWERS WITH BLUE CHEESE DIPPING SAUCE
Make and share this Buffalo Chicken Skewers With Blue Cheese Dipping Sauce recipe from Food.com.
Provided by gailanng
Categories Chicken Breast
Time 30m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ine butter, hot sauce, cider vinegar and dressing mix in heavy saucepan. Stir over low heat until smooth. Taste and add more hot sauce if desired.
- Spray grill or broiler pan with no-stick cooking spray; heat grill or broiler.
- Place chicken tenders in large bowl; drizzle with oil. Toss to coat. Season with salt and pepper. Thread each chicken tender onto a wooden skewer.
- Grill or broil until cooked through and golden brown, about 8 to 10 minutes. Brush generously with Buffalo Sauce in the last minutes of cooking. Serve with blue cheese dressing for dipping.
